你查询的IP:[119.132.19.159]  地理位置:中国–广东–珠海

最新查询119.60.61.130 120.235.168.65 221.48.234.160 119.196.75.161 60.105.126.225 221.102.152.90 218.168.12.168 60.234.165.104 119.235.13.236 119.132.19.159 119.42.136.252 202.60.112.91 120.64.127.231 202.67.110.144 120.72.32.150 221.176.245.252 167.139.36.87 219.244.11.253 125.58.128.9 61.45.128.37 220.160.82.42 123.56.234.109 124.31.43.100 202.149.160.97 119.41.94.116 203.128.32.97 58.24.186.84 123.108.208.54 119.27.64.205 124.108.8.249 58.24.235.244